Fokus Mining Total Liabilities Calculation

Total Liabilities are the liabilities that the company has to pay others. It is a part of the balance sheet of a company that shareholders do not own, and would be obligated to pay back if the company liquidated.

Fokus Mining's Total Liabilities for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2024 is calculated as

Total Liabilities=Total Assets (A: Dec. 2024 )-Total Equity (A: Dec. 2024 )
=8.157-7.976
=0.18

Fokus Mining's Total Liabilities for the quarter that ended in Sep. 2025 is calculated as

Total Liabilities=Total Assets (Q: Sep. 2025 )-Total Equity (Q: Sep. 2025 )
=9.373-9.308
=0.06

Fokus Mining Business Description

Address 147, Quebec Avenue, Rouyn-Noranda, QC, CAN, J9X 6M8
Fokus Mining Corp is a mineral resource company. The company is a exploration stage corporation, is in the business of acquiring, exploring and developing mining properties and it holds interests in properties at the exploration stage located in Canada.
